Darien Rotary Takes Action in COVID-19 Crisis
Darien Rotary Club members are people of action - we're taking action during the COVID-19 crisis

Nobody expected COVID-19, but when it arrived, the people of the Darien Rotary Club sprang into action. Their actions so far are:
- Area food banks report a 70% increase in demand and a 40% decrease in donations, so the club gave $5000 in cash donations to 5 area food banks.
- The club counts on local restaurants to donate food and time to our Taste of Route 66 event, but with restaurants limited to takeout only, their revenues are crashing and they are being forced to lay people off. To thank and help our restaurant supporters, the club donated $4500 to nine area restaurants.
- A key secondary mission of the club is promoting literacy. The club gave $1000 to support Darien schools' summer literacy program.
- The Darien Rotary Club is part of Rotary International, which has 1.3 million members in over 160 countries. As part of their international mission, they are donating $1000 to a project which will buy PPE for hospitals in Honduras.
